2008 NARHA Sis Gould Driving Recognition Award

Nomination Information
Driving has expanded the world of equine assisted activities and offered the power of the horse to change lives to some new participants who were formerly unable to experience this world.  Please help NARHA identify an individual who has exemplified outstanding dedication to the development and promotion of driving for individuals with disabilities.  This person may be a NARHA instructor who has demonstrated exceptional skills in teaching, a participant who utilizes skills learned in a NARHA driving program to excel in competition, or a program developer who has worked to develop and promote driving activities for individuals with disabilities.

The award recipient will be presented with an award and recognized at the 2008 NARHA National Conference and Annual Meeting Awards Banquet on November 1, 2008.

Help NARHA Celebrate Driving and the 2007 Sis Gould Driving Award Recipient!
Tom Cramer has been essential in the development of HETRA’s program: his vision hard work and long hours have made the driving program a reality,” wrote Jodi Teal in her nomination. Tom has been A NARHA Certified Registered Riding Instructor since March 04 and a Certified Driving Instructor since December, 2004. 

Tom Cramer is HETRA’s first and only driving instructor. He currently instructs at two HETRA facilities in the Omaha area. His equine partners are: three driving horses and one driving pony. Not only does he verify that the driving equines are reliable and obedient in all conditions and circumstances, but in his attention to safety, he ensures that the harnesses used are strong, fit correctly, and are regularly maintained and inspected. He also levels and grades the HETRA driving facility, providing a smooth surface that is free of holes and obstacles.
